Key Tools and Technologies
Social media marketers need to be familiar with a range of key tools and technologies to succeed in their roles. These include:
- Data analysis and visualization tools: Google Analytics, Excel, Tableau, and Power BI are just a few examples of data analysis and visualization tools commonly used in social media marketing.
- Social media management tools: Hootsuite, Sprout Social, and Buffer are just a few examples of social media management tools commonly used in social media marketing.
- Content creation and curation platforms: Canva, Adobe Creative Cloud, and WordPress are just a few examples of content creation and curation platforms commonly used in social media marketing.

Designing a Show-Stopping Portfolio for Social Media Marketing Professionals
A well-designed portfolio is essential for showcasing your skills, work, and achievements as a social media marketer. When creating your portfolio, focus on the following tips:
* Showcase your best work, including successful campaigns, challenges overcome, and lessons learned.
* Highlight your skills and expertise in areas such as content creation, influencer marketing, paid social media advertising, and analytics.
* Use case studies to demonstrate your problem-solving skills and ability to meet client objectives.
* Include testimonials and feedback from clients, colleagues, or managers to add credibility and social proof.
* Make sure your portfolio is visually appealing, easy to navigate, and optimized for mobile devices.

When it comes to preparing for interviews, it’s essential to be ready to talk about your experience, skills, and knowledge. Here are some tips to help you ace your next social media marketing interview:
Preparing for Social Media Marketing Interviews, Social media marketing jobs near me
Before the interview:
* Review the company’s social media profiles and look for common themes, such as branding, engagement, and customer service.
* Prepare examples of successful social media campaigns you’ve managed or executed.
* Research industry trends and news to demonstrate your understanding of the ever-changing social media landscape.
During the interview:
* Be prepared to talk about your experience with social media management tools, such as Hootsuite, Sprout Social, or Buffer.
* Share your knowledge of social media metrics and analytics, such as engagement rates, follower growth, and conversions.
* Emphasize your ability to think strategically and creatively when it comes to social media marketing.
